猪脂肪细胞决定和分化因子1基因(ADD1)中一个新SNP的特性及其对肉质性状影响

Characterization of a Novel SNP of Porcine Adipocyte Determination and Differentiation Factor-1 Gene (ADD1) and Its Effects on Meat Quality

【摘要】 脂肪细胞决定和分化因子1(adipocyte determination and differentiation factor-1,ADD1)基因与人类和鼠的脂肪细胞分化具有确定的连锁关系。在脂肪细胞分化过程中,ADD1与转录因子PPARγ和C/EBP发挥着关键的作用。本研究克隆了保守DNA序列并用PCR-SSCP和直接测序法鉴定其多态性。同时,选择136头猪作为实验群体来探索其与肉质性状的关系。多态性分析发现:在第二外显子内一个导致错义突变的SNP,该SNP在实验群体内分布不平衡,未检测到AA基因型。相关分析结果显示,ADD1不同基因型间在肌内蛋白(MP)和肉色(MC)存在显著(P<0.05)的差异;肌内脂肪(IMF)存在极显著(P<0.01)的差异。说明,ADD1基因多态性有可能应用到提高肉质的育种实践中。

【Abstract】 Adipocyte determination and dfferentiation factor-1 gene (ADD1),a gene associated with adipocyte differentiation in the research of human and rat,plays a role during adipocyte differentiation with PPARγ and C/EBP.In this paper,we cloned a part of the gene sequence from pig,screened it with PCR-SSCP (single strand conformation polymorphism),and used sequencing to identify mutation.The result indicated that a SNP (single nucleotide polymorphism) happened in the conservative domain of the ADD1 gene,which led to a different amino-acid sequence and a new site for proteinase.To verity the relationship between this mutation and meat quality,we chose 136 pigs as the experimental population,all of which were butchered to determine meat quality.The result of polymorphism analysis showed that a novel SNP was found in second exon.The polymorphism was disequilibrium in population and AA genotype was not found in it.The relation analysis showed that intramuscular protein,intramuscular fat and meat color had obviously difference among different ADD1 genotypes of pigs.The ADD1 polymorphism can apply to pig breeding for improving meat quality.
